On this page we describe our experimental systems and benchmarks used for their evaluation. To support reproducible research, we make available the source code of systems and benchmarks used in experimental evaluation under open source license.
PersistentDS¶
We develop PersistentDS, an open source NoSQL data store system. It’s main features are following:
strong consistency
acute replicated data types
effcient recovery after crashes
support of NVM
See research papers for details.
Benchmarks¶
We use the following standard benchmarks:
…
For evaluation of crash-recovery we designed the following tests:
…
Download¶
All software is available under open source license.
Computing¶
We conduct experimental evaluation using three computing facilties:
Six Inspur servers, equipped with Intel® Xeon® Gold 6252N CPU 2.30GHz and Intel® Optane™ DC persistent memory (DCPMM) (see the full specification)
HPC cluster, equipped with Intel® Xeon® X3230 (4×2.66 GHz, 8 MB L2 cache), 1Gbps LAN (running at wire speed), OpenJDK 1.7.0_40, openSUSE 12.3
EAGLE cluster, equipped with Huawei E9000 Blade Server, Xeon E5-2697v3 14C 2.6GHz, 56G Infiniband FDR Huawei Technologies Co., Ltd., 32 984 Cores, Rmax 1013.7 [TFlops/s], 1372.1 Rpeak [TFlops/s], 550 kW, located at Poznań Supercomputing and Networking Center (90th in the world’s TOP500 in June 2016) [photo]